Наименование прибора: FCH077N65FF085
Тип транзистора: MOSFET
Полярность: N
Pdⓘ - Максимальная рассеиваемая мощность: 481 W
|Vds|ⓘ - Предельно допустимое напряжение сток-исток: 650 V
|Vgs|ⓘ - Предельно допустимое напряжение затвор-исток: 20 V
|Id|ⓘ - Максимально допустимый постоянный ток стока: 54 A
Tjⓘ - Максимальная температура канала: 150 °C
trⓘ - Время нарастания: 27 ns
Cossⓘ - Выходная емкость: 5629 pf
Rdsⓘ - Сопротивление сток-исток открытого транзистора: 0.077 Ohm
Тип корпуса: TO247
